Dr Solomon's Anti-Virus Toolkit v8.03/4 for Windows NT
If Reflex Sherlock is selected as the 2nd scanner within CHECKNT, then from within the Dr Solomon's 'Exclusions' tab the following must be added to the directory where Windows NT is installed: (D:\)temp\dnunzip\temp. This is the directory that Reflex Sherlock unzips zip files to from a floppy disk to scan for viruses within CHECKNT then deletes them after scanning.
WARNING! Floppy disks with password protected zip files will not generate any errors. The disk will be authorised without checking inside these files. We would recommend running Reflex Sherlock alongside this scanner to prevent any viruses potentially getting through (although Reflex Sherlock will not scan inside these files, it will generate an error, and hence the disk will not be authorised).

Infected Trojan's in a zip file will report the following error; 'The File C:\DnetNT\Report.Log does not contain recognised information'.
Disknet Changes: Added an exclusion to the file "FINDV32.EXE", using the '#' command to allow the hard disk to be fully scanned without PSG alerts. Which should be already in your Reflex Disknet Expresset.ini file |
